SQL Inner-Join查询
我正在尝试进行内部加入,但我可以使它起作用。 这是我的SQL查询
SELECT highscore.score, bruger.brugerNavn FROM highscore INNER JOIN bruger ON highscore.brugerID ON bruger.brugerID ORDER BY score DESC
,我最终会出现此错误,
SELECT highscore.score, bruger.brugerNavn FROM highscore INNER JOIN bruger ON highscore.brugerID ON bruger.brugerID LIMIT 0, 25
#1064 - There is an error in the SQL syntax near 'ON bruger.brugerID LIMIT 0, 25' at line 1
我将感谢任何帮助:)
I'm trying to make a inner-join, but I can get it to work.
This is my sql query
SELECT highscore.score, bruger.brugerNavn FROM highscore INNER JOIN bruger ON highscore.brugerID ON bruger.brugerID ORDER BY score DESC
I end up with this error
SELECT highscore.score, bruger.brugerNavn FROM highscore INNER JOIN bruger ON highscore.brugerID ON bruger.brugerID LIMIT 0, 25
#1064 - There is an error in the SQL syntax near 'ON bruger.brugerID LIMIT 0, 25' at line 1
I would appreciate any help:)
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(4)
首先尝试一下:
我通常会添加别名,以更轻松地处理。
Try this first:
I usually add aliases for easier handling.
你也这样尝试
You also try like that
您需要在bg.brugerid上替换
hs.brugerid
用hs.brugerid = bg.brugerid
在内部加入下You need to replace
HS.brugerID on BG.brugerID
withHS.brugerID = BG.brugerID
under inner join